How it works

Train once, inspect continuously, prove everything.

01
Train
Build a molecular fingerprint from validated authentic material.
02
Inspect
Field-scan on any portable NIR device with the mobile app.
03
Verdict
Authentic, deviating or anomalous — in seconds.
04
Evidence
Every scan hashed and timestamped on the XRP Ledger.
